In both programs you can import all 3ds and OBj and Pz3 and and much more formats. But you cannot export anything from Vue 4. You only can export from vue 4 Pro.

If you have only Vue without the included Mover, you can import pz3 stills from Poser (figures, objects). Mover 5 allows you to import fully animated scenes from Poser into Vue. Then you can add vegetations or whatever. The demo mov you have seen at e-on's site were made with Vue 4 Pro. But the creator, Phoul (Philippe Boyer), has created lots of animations with Vue 4 and Mover 4. Have a look at his site www.belino.net
